Item: Moonlit Ink

Level2
Rarity
Uncommon
CategoryOther
Price5 gp
UsageHeld in one hand
PublicationPathfinder Dark Archive (Remastered)

Activate 1 (manipulate)

Access Member of a secret society


This alchemical ink is applied to a stamping device, typically a wooden seal or chop commissioned by the secret society and costing 1 sp. When the seal is pressed to paper, the ink briefly shows up before fading into invisibility. The stamp can be revealed by exposing the stamped item to direct moonlight for 1 minute. A character checking a good or document marked by a moonlit ink stamp must succeed at a DC 25 Perception check to spot the stamp without exposure to moonlight. In addition to its use by secret societies for their secret books, papers, and messages, some smugglers use moonlit ink to mark their goods.


Trait Effects

Alchemical: Alchemical items are powered by reactions of alchemical reagents. Unless otherwise noted, alchemical items aren’t magical and don’t radiate a magical aura. Alchemical creatures are partially powered by alchemical reactions.

Consumable: An item with this trait can be used only once. Unless stated otherwise, it’s destroyed after activation. Consumable items include alchemical items and magical consumables such as scrolls and talismans. A character can Craft consumable items in batches of four.
